Moiraine was considered for the throne because she was going to become Aes Sedai...and her sisters weren't queen material. No one in House Damodred would support them for the throne, so there was no need for any other House to kill them off.

I happen to agree with those that think Moiraine's sisters are alive, but personally I think they are unimportant.

 

I think her sisters aren't even of any huge relevance, they were just created to give Moiraine more of a backround, and don't have much merit for themselves. We don't even meet them, and aside from that one conversation with Jarna Sedai, they are never mentioned in NS. RJ notes (as Marie already mentioned) that neither had suitable personalities for Queen and no one would support them - which puts them neatly out of the future plot of the War of Sucession in Cairhien.

 

Therefore they have no need to appear in the mainstream WoT plot....but perhaps in the other prequel RJ has said he will write (the one covering Moiraine/Lan's exploits on their way to the Two Rivers) one or more of Moiraine's kin will show themselves.

They probably look more alike than most families: any noble class of any country has limited options for breeding, unless they want to draw from the peasant stock - which is considered highly distasteful, unless it's only once in a while.

 

But the Damodreds have been ruling Cairhien for centuries, I think 500 years they maintained power becuase of their control over the Silk Path. (I may be wrong *gasp* on the number of centuries, I can remember the passage that lists it, but not where to find it to check myself. I will do that later.)

 

So Damodreds have been kings and queens and more liekly to form arranged/political marriages with noble families, and after centuries, this becomes a problem, because all your suitors are related to you in some way. Therefore, cousins are more likely to look alike when they come from a small-branched family tree.
